Difficult childbirth dream: what does it mean?

Difficult childbirth in a dream shifts the focus from new beginnings to the struggle before them. It suggests you sense real effort, fear, or resistance standing between you and something you're trying to bring into being.

Dreaming of “childbirth” with a detail

A plain childbirth dream often centers on new beginnings and change. Adding difficulty narrows that meaning: your mind is highlighting the strain, fear, or uncertainty involved in getting there. This can show up when you're pushing through a hard project, a tough decision, or a long stretch of effort where the outcome still feels unclear.

It doesn't need to be about an actual pregnancy or medical worry. The dreaming mind often borrows the image of a hard labor to describe any situation where you're straining to produce something, whether that's a piece of work, a relationship milestone, or a personal change that keeps testing your patience and stamina.

Good signs

Even a hard labor in a dream usually ends with a baby. This suggests that whatever you're struggling with is still moving forward, and your effort is not wasted. The dream can be a sign that you're capable of pushing through something demanding to reach a good result.

What to watch for

If the fear or pain in the dream feels overwhelming, it may point to real anxiety about a current challenge feeling too big to handle alone. It can be worth noticing if you're taking on more pressure than you need to, or hesitating to ask for support.

Frequently asked questions

Does dreaming about a difficult childbirth mean something is wrong with my pregnancy?

No. Dreams like this are common during real pregnancies and usually reflect normal anxiety about labor, not a prediction. If you have specific medical concerns, it's always best to talk with your doctor rather than your dreams.

Why do I dream of a hard labor when I'm not pregnant and don't plan to be?

These dreams often use birth as a symbol for any effortful process, like finishing a big project or making a major life change. The difficulty in the dream usually mirrors real strain or pressure you're feeling in that situation.

Is a difficult childbirth dream a bad omen?

Not at all. Most dream traditions and everyday psychology see it as a reflection of current stress or effort, not a warning. In fact, most of these dreams end with the baby arriving safely, which points toward eventual relief.
